Adaptive beam control of dual beam phased array antenna system

Abstract

In this study, the Dual Beam Phased Array Antenna System designedfor COST260* project is upgraded to have the abilities of beamsteering, tracking and direction finding by providing the necessarycomputer codes using C++ Programming Language. The functions ofnew prototype are tested to verify the operation.*COST260 project was an adaptive phased array receiving antennasystem for satellite communication, which was operating at 11.49-11.678 GHz band.
